Hello – We’ve connected our ICG with our UMS. We’re now connecting a test device. In the Cloud Gateway Agent Setup it wants the 4th part of the Certificate Fingerprint – no problem. It shows a field for “ICG One-Time Password”. Never saw this field in setting up the ICG or UMS. Searches only say “ICG One-Time Password: The one-time-password you received from your system administrator.” (that would be me). Is it the same as the “First Authentication Key” in the ICG info file? Thanks, Matthew
